How to Clean Your PVC Dog Collar Leash
Your waterproof PVC dog collar and leash are great for keeping your pet comfortable and looking good.
To keep them in great shape, follow these easy cleaning tips:
**Vinegar Cleaning:**
- Use vinegar, a natural and pet-safe cleaner. Just dampen a cloth with a bit of vinegar and wipe the collar and leash. For a deeper clean, let the PVC soak in vinegar before wiping it off.
**Lemon Stain Removal:**
- Lemons are great at getting rid of tough stains. Squeeze half a lemon, let the juice sit for 30 minutes, then apply it to a cloth to clean stubborn spots.
**Baking Soda Paste:**
- Mix lemon juice with baking soda to make a paste. Apply this paste to stains and gently scrub. Rinse and repeat if needed. Baking Soda is safe and effective at removing stains.
**Alcohol for Tough Stains:**
- Use rubbing alcohol or white spirits to clean dirty spots. Let it sit, then wipe off. For really stubborn stains, use an old toothbrush to gently scrub.
**Important Reminders:**
- Don't use harsh materials like steel wool; they can damage your gear.
- Clean regularly to keep your collar and leash looking new and stain-free.
